Season Five of Interview With An Artist is Gallery Directors from around Australia.
William Mansfield, the Gallery Manager of Arthouse Gallery on the land originally known as Kogerah by the Gadigal people or Rushcutters Bay, joins us this week.
Will first joined the gallery in a part time capacity after graduating with first class honours from COFA. Over the last 13 years working in the gallery, Will’s focus gradually shifted away from his own art practice to being focused full time in the gallery.
In today’s episode we talk about:
- the importance of accessibility in the art world and why Will feels strongly about it
- the role Will sees himself playing for the artists they work with
- what they look for in new artists they bring into the gallery and where they find them
- how they keep the rotation of shows interesting for all
Will was so gracious with his answers and provides valuable insights for any artist who has ever aspired to Arthouse Gallery.
